Can You Fit a Towbar to a Peugeot Partner Yourself?
Fitting a towbar to a Peugeot Partner is well within reach of a competent DIY mechanic, provided you have the right tools, a safe working space and a full afternoon to spare. The Partner has been designed with dedicated chassis mounting points on both sides of the rear underbody, which means most modern towbar kits bolt straight on without the need for drilling. That said, the job does involve working under the van, handling heavy steel components and integrating with the vehicle's electrical system, so it is not something to rush.
Whether you're towing a small trailer for garden waste, a plant trailer for work, or a caravan for weekends away, the principles are the same. The main considerations are choosing a towbar that is type-approved for the Partner (look for an EC 94/20 or R55 approval number), making sure your wiring is compatible with the Partner's CAN-Bus electrical architecture on later models, and torquing every bolt correctly. Get those three things right and a home fit will be just as safe as a garage installation.
Tools and Parts You'll Need Before Starting
Before you start unbolting anything, lay out everything you'll need so you don't have to break off halfway through. At a minimum you'll want a good trolley jack and a pair of axle stands, a socket set including deep sockets in the 17mm to 21mm range, a torque wrench capable of reaching around 100 Nm, a set of Torx bits (T20 to T50 covers most Partner fixings), a trim removal tool, wire strippers, crimps and heat shrink, plus a multimeter for checking the electrics. A second pair of hands is invaluable when it comes to lifting the towbar into place.
On the parts side, you'll need a Peugeot Partner-specific towbar kit (generic universal bars rarely line up correctly), a wiring kit matched to your intended use, and ideally a small tub of copper grease or thread lock for the mounting bolts. Check the box contents against the fitting instructions before you start — missing a single spacer plate can bring the whole job to a halt.
Choosing the Right Towbar Type (Flange, Swan Neck or Detachable)
There are three common towbar styles to consider for a Partner. A fixed flange towbar uses a bolt-on tow ball and is the most versatile option — it lets you fit bumper protection plates, stabilisers and high/low adjustable necks, which is why it remains popular with tradespeople who tow trailers regularly. A swan neck towbar has a smoother, one-piece appearance and is neater for occasional caravan use, but it doesn't accept accessories as easily. A detachable towbar combines a clean look when not in use with the strength of a fixed bar, and is a great choice if you want the Partner to double as a family vehicle at weekends.
Cost typically rises in that order, with detachable neck systems being the most expensive. Whichever you pick, make sure it is specifically listed for the Partner generation you own — the pre-2008, 2008–2018 and post-2018 (K9) models all use different mounting arrangements.
Wiring Kits: 7-Pin vs 13-Pin Explained
The wiring kit is what turns your trailer's lights and, on a caravan, its interior electrics into a working extension of the van. A 7-pin single electrics kit handles the basics: indicators, brake lights, tail lights, fog and reverse. It's ideal if you're only ever going to tow a box trailer, plant trailer or small unbraked utility trailer. A 13-pin kit combines those functions with a permanent live and a switched live feed, powering caravan fridges, leisure batteries and interior lighting.
Later Peugeot Partner models use a CAN-Bus system, meaning a dedicated vehicle-specific wiring kit is required — you cannot simply splice into the rear light wiring as you might on older vans. A vehicle-specific kit plugs into a dedicated port and often needs coding via a diagnostic tool so the van "knows" a trailer is attached, activating trailer stability control and disabling rear parking sensors when the towbar is in use.
Step-by-Step: How to Fit a Towbar to a Peugeot Partner
With the tools laid out and the kit checked, you're ready to start. Park the van on level ground, chock the front wheels, and read the manufacturer's fitting instructions all the way through before you pick up a spanner. The steps below give an overview of what to expect, but always follow the specific torque figures and sequences supplied with your particular towbar.
Step 1 – Preparing the Van and Removing the Rear Bumper
Start by disconnecting the negative terminal of the battery — this protects the ECU when you're working near the rear wiring later. Open the rear doors and remove the plastic scuff plate along the load area sill, then locate the bumper fixings. On most Partner models this means unclipping the wheel arch liners at each end, removing two or three Torx screws inside each arch, and undoing the bolts hidden along the top edge of the bumper. Some models also have fixings accessed from underneath.
With all fasteners out, gently pull the bumper rearward and away from the van. It should slide free once the side clips release. If the van has rear parking sensors, disconnect the sensor loom before you fully separate the bumper. Set it aside somewhere it won't get scratched.
Step 2 – Bolting the Towbar to the Chassis Mounting Points
You should now be able to see the factory towbar mounting points on the underside of the chassis rails. Clean any road dirt away and check for corrosion. Offer the towbar up — this is genuinely a two-person job as the bar is heavy and awkward. Start every bolt by hand to make sure the threads are engaging cleanly, then run them up finger tight before you reach for the torque wrench.
Once everything is aligned, work through the bolts in the sequence given in your fitting instructions and torque each one to the specified value, typically between 80 and 110 Nm. Apply a dab of thread lock if the manufacturer recommends it. Give the bar a firm shake once torqued — there should be zero movement.
Step 3 – Connecting the Electrical Wiring Loom
Feed the wiring loom through the grommet in the rear panel and route it forward along the existing chassis looms, using cable ties to keep it away from moving parts and hot exhaust components. On a vehicle-specific kit you'll find a dedicated plug-and-play connector behind a trim panel in the boot area — locate it, plug in the loom, and secure the control module in place with the supplied Velcro or bracket.
If you have a non-vehicle-specific kit, you'll be splicing into the rear light wiring using scotch locks or, ideally, solder joints with heat shrink. Take your time to identify each wire correctly with a multimeter before cutting anything. Mount the 7-pin or 13-pin socket to the towbar bracket, connect the earth wire securely to a clean chassis point, and coil any excess loom out of the way.
Step 4 – Refitting the Bumper and Testing
Some towbar kits require a small section of the bumper's lower valance to be cut out to allow clearance for the tow ball or neck — check the template supplied and mark carefully before cutting. Reconnect the parking sensor loom if fitted, then offer the bumper back up and clip it into place, refitting all screws and bolts in reverse order.
Reconnect the battery and test every function. Plug a trailer board or a known-good trailer into the socket and check indicators, brake lights, tail lights, fog and reverse. If a vehicle-specific kit needs coding, this is the moment to plug in a diagnostic tool (or take it to a specialist) to enable trailer mode. Finish by hitching up a light trailer and checking clearance and geometry before your first proper tow.
Fitting a Towbar to a Peugeot Partner LWB (Long Wheelbase)
Fitting a towbar to the long wheelbase Partner is essentially the same job as on the standard short wheelbase, but there are a few differences worth flagging. The LWB has additional chassis length behind the rear axle, which means the towbar itself is a different part number with a longer or differently shaped extension arm — never try to force a SWB bar onto an LWB, or vice versa.
The wiring loom is also longer and the routing runs further along the underbody. Take extra care to keep it well clear of the exhaust and secure it every 30cm or so with cable ties. Because the LWB has a longer rear overhang, nose weight calculations become more sensitive, so pay close attention to trailer loading once fitted.
Peugeot Partner Towing Capacity and Dimensions to Know
Before you tow anything, check the exact figures for your specific Partner in the V5C and the driver's handbook, as they vary by engine, trim and year. As a general guide, most modern Partner vans have a braked towing capacity of around 1,000 to 1,500kg depending on engine, with an unbraked limit of 750kg. Nose weight is typically limited to around 75kg on the tow ball itself, though the towbar's own rating may be higher — always work to the lower of the two figures.
The standard tow ball height is around 350–420mm from the ground when unladen. Also check your gross train weight (GTW) on the vehicle plate: this is the total permitted weight of van plus trailer combined, and it's the figure that most often trips people up when they overload a caravan or plant trailer.
Common Problems and Pitfalls When Fitting a Partner Towbar
The most frequent issue people run into is corroded factory bolts, especially on Partners that have spent winters on salted roads. Soak them in penetrating fluid the night before you start and don't be afraid to use a breaker bar. Rounded heads are a nightmare to remove with the bumper still in the way. A close second is misaligned mounting points caused by past rear-end knocks — if the towbar won't sit flush, don't force it, investigate why.
Electrical gremlins are the other big pitfall. Fitting a generic wiring kit to a CAN-Bus Partner can trigger warning lights, disable rear fog lights or cause the trailer indicators to flash at double speed. Always use a Partner-specific wiring kit and be prepared to have it coded in. Finally, don't forget to update your insurer — a towbar fitted at home is still a modification that most insurers want to know about.
When to Use a Professional Fitter Instead
Home fitting saves money, but it isn't for everyone. If you don't have access to axle stands or a level, hard-standing driveway, if your Partner is a late model with a heavily integrated CAN-Bus system that needs main-dealer-level coding, or if you simply don't fancy spending four hours under a van, a professional fitter will typically complete the job in two to three hours with a full guarantee on parts and labour.
Mobile fitters will come to your home or workplace, which is often cheaper than a franchised dealer and more convenient than dropping the van off. Expect to pay a few hundred pounds all in, depending on towbar type and wiring specification. For fleet users, having a professional invoice on file also simplifies any future warranty or insurance claims.

Do I need to code the Peugeot Partner after fitting a towbar?
On older pre-CAN-Bus Partners, no — the wiring is a simple splice into the rear lights. On later models with CAN-Bus electrics, a vehicle-specific wiring kit is required and coding via a diagnostic tool is usually needed to enable trailer mode, activate stability control and disable rear parking sensors when a trailer is attached.
